• linkedu视频
  • 平面设计
  • 电脑入门
  • 操作系统
  • 办公应用
  • 电脑硬件
  • 动画设计
  • 3D设计
  • 网页设计
  • CAD设计
  • 影音处理
  • 数据库
  • 程序设计
  • 认证考试
  • 信息管理
  • 信息安全
菜单
linkedu.com专业计算机教程网站
  • 网页制作
  • 数据库
  • 程序设计
  • 操作系统
  • CMS教程
  • 游戏攻略
  • 脚本语言
  • 平面设计
  • 软件教程
  • 网络安全
  • 电脑知识
  • 服务器
  • 视频教程
  • html/xhtml
  • html5
  • CSS
  • XML/XSLT
  • Dreamweaver教程
  • Frontpage教程
  • 心得技巧
  • bootstrap
  • vue
  • AngularJS
  • HBuilder教程
  • css3
  • 浏览器兼容
  • div/css
  • 网页编辑器
  • axure
您的位置:首页 > 网页设计 >html5 > HTML5与Flash比较的详细介绍

HTML5与Flash比较的详细介绍

作者:匿名 字体:[增加 减小] 来源:互联网 时间:2018-12-03

本文主要包含HTML5,Flash等相关知识,匿名希望在学习及工作中可以帮助到您
HTML5,这个目前互联网最为火爆的词语牵动着无数厂商,用户的心。虽然HTML5规范迟迟无法完全确定,但各大浏览器厂商和视频服务供应商已经开始抓住HTML5准备抢占市场先机同时给自己造势了。无论是Google还是Mozilla以及苹果,似乎都准备将HTML5作为下一代网络视频播放的主要手段,而他们共同的目标似乎就是干掉以往一直由Flash垄断的视频播放器(随着微软silverlit的出现Flash的优势已经逐步褪去了),那HTML5 VS Flash到底有何缺点?我们一起来看看。

  世界上最大的视频站点Youtube最近一直在积极推行网站的无Flash化改革,他们甚至还推出了供试用的HTML5播放器,不过本周早些时 候,Youtube表示了对HTML5播放器的一些担忧。

  目前所有的浏览器厂商都计划今年晚些时候向HTML5标准转型,这其中包括了微软的IE9.而谷歌的Android手机平台和微软的Windows Phone7平台则会继续支持Flash播放器,与此同时,尽管苹果的Safari5可以兼容Flash,但是该浏览器在iPhone/iPod /iPad上的的版本却不会支持Flash播放器。

  然而,Youtube却在这个时候就即将替换传统Flash播放器的新HTML5播放器表示出了一些担忧。首先,尽管同属HTML5标准,但各款浏览器在使用HTML5标准播放视频时所使用的编码技术却未必相同,而对Youtube这样视频数量巨大的网站而言,最理想的情况是尽量控制这些视频所使用的编码器种类,否则将很难做统一的处理。

  就目前的情况来看,谷歌,Opera和Mozilla三家公司支持的是谷歌主导的WebM VP8视频编码器引擎,VP8是一款开源编码器引擎。微软和苹果公司则是商业化的H.264编码器的支持者,不过微软的IE9则可允许用户自由选择安装 WebM引擎。

  在各家浏览器厂商仍未就视频编码器的格式达成一致之前,Youtube表示会继续沿用现有的H.264格式,他们自从2007年起便一直使用的是这种格式。

  不仅是编码器方面,HTML5播放器在播放视频流时的性能和系统资源的利用等方面也存在一些问题,而在播放实时视频时,是否能完全控制系统缓冲和视频画质对播放器的性能是非常重要的。除此之外,DRM盗版防护技术也是会令Youtube感到头疼的问题之一,预计他们很可能会提供类似网上租片一类的服务,这种服务可能只允许一部分购买了授权的用户观看,而且用户无权将这些视频拷贝下来并在网上分发。

  用过HTML5播放器的人都知道,使用这种播放器需要对网页进行比较大的改动。另外,HTML5播放器在播放视频过程中如果用户通过拉动播放条跳动到视频的下一段,播放器总是会有1-2秒的延迟,而Flash播放器则一般不存在这类问题。

  下图是两张在Chrome6.0.447.0浏览器+Wiondows7 64位旗舰版操作系统中分别运行HTML5视频播放器和Flash10.1.53.64播放器播放视频时的画面对比,不论从视频载入的等待时间,还是从视频的质量来看,Flash都具备一定的优势。

html5与flash对比

html5与flash对比

第三,Youtube网站还具备将外网视频直接嵌入的功能,而HTML5在这方面的表现则一般不如Flash。

  最后,HTML5播放器并不能支持摄像头/麦克风,而眼下Youtube网站的Flash播放器却可以支持使用播放器直接摄像头/麦克风现场录制视频的功能,没有Flash,这一点是很难做到的。

  可见尽管不少媒体和厂商几乎已经将HTML5吹上了天,但是从实际应用的角度,HTML5播放器其实还有很多需要进一步改进的地方,而它要想取代 Flash播放器目前的地位,仍然有很长一段路要走。

以上就是HTML5与Flash比较的详细介绍的详细内容,更多请关注微课江湖其它相关文章!

您可能想查找下面的文章:

  • HTML5知识点总结
  • HTML5的本地存储
  • HTML5本地存储之IndexedDB
  • Html5实现文件异步上传功能
  • Html5新标签datalist实现输入框与后台数据库数据的动态匹配
  • 详解HTML5 window.postMessage与跨域
  • HTML5拖放API实现拖放排序的实例代码
  • 解决html5中video标签无法播放mp4问题的办法
  • HTML5新特性 多线程(Worker SharedWorker)
  • Html5新增标签有哪些

相关文章

  • 2018-12-03安卓平台的浏览器 touchend 事件触发失效?
  • 2018-12-03具体介绍HTML5表单新增属性
  • 2018-12-03HTML5+Canvas调用手机拍照功能实现图片上传功能(图文详解上篇)
  • 2018-12-03分享一个用html5实现炮弹自由落体的实例代码
  • 2018-12-03html5实现移动端下拉刷新(原理和代码)
  • 2018-12-03HTML5学习笔记简明版(6):新增属性(1)
  • 2018-12-03设计师视角看HTML5
  • 2018-12-03详细介绍HTML5简易在线画图工具的实现案例
  • 2018-12-03使用html5+css3来实现slider切换效果告别javascript+css_html5教程技巧
  • 2018-12-03在HTML5中使用MathML数学公式的简单讲解_html5教程技巧

文章分类

  • html/xhtml
  • html5
  • CSS
  • XML/XSLT
  • Dreamweaver教程
  • Frontpage教程
  • 心得技巧
  • bootstrap
  • vue
  • AngularJS
  • HBuilder教程
  • css3
  • 浏览器兼容
  • div/css
  • 网页编辑器
  • axure

最近更新的内容

    • phonegap使用方法介绍(六)获取设备的信息方法
    • Canvas实现圆形进度条并显示数字百分比
    • html5中在用户开始拖动元素或选择的文本时触发的事件ondragstart
    • 让ie浏览器成为支持html5的浏览器的解决方法(使用html5shiv)
    • 利用图片预加载组件提升html5移动页面的用户体验
    • H5有哪些清空画布方法
    • H5学习之旅-H5的基本标签(2)
    • H5 的复制操作实例代码
    • HTML5标签嵌套规则详解【必看】
    • web开发的迷茫,希望有前辈能告诉一下方向?

关于我们 - 联系我们 - 免责声明 - 网站地图

©2020-2025 All Rights Reserved. linkedu.com 版权所有